Structural Design and Reliability Research of Cutting Reducer for Horizontal Axis Roadway Driving Machine
-
Abstract
Objective To address the issues of high failure rate of high-speed shafts and output mechanisms, serious oil leakage of floating seals, and high oil temperature in the gearbox of current high-power horizontal axis roadway driving machine cutting reducers, a new type of cutting reducer structure with high reliability was designed to improve its operational stability and service life. Methods A four-stage transmission system composed of helical gear transmission, bevel gear transmission, NGW planetary transmission, and fixed shaft train was adopted to achieve power transmission and speed reduction. A sealing structure combining metal seal rings and dust seals was used, with V-rings and labyrinth rings arranged to enhance the dustproof and wear resistance of the floating seal. An independent forced lubrication and cooling system and a multi-chamber separation structure were designed to provide directional cooling and lubrication for key transmission components, thereby controlling the overall oil temperature. Results The designed reducer structure achieved a highly reliable connection with the drum, effectively preventing dust intrusion and lubricating oil leakage. The multi-chamber design and forced cooling system significantly reduced local oil temperature, avoiding premature failure of seals caused by high temperature. Conclusion The structural design of this horizontal axis roadway driving machine cutting reducer is reasonable, effectively solving engineering problems such as oil leakage, high temperature, and inconvenient maintenance. It has high practical value and reliability, and is suitable for driving operations under high-power and hard rock conditions.
